I use the FP insert wizards to generate the code automatically, and do not
want to get into programming. (I want to spend my time making money not
coding!)
I have an Access database embeded in a site. It uses ASP pages to return data.
Recently my ISP provider moved from an older versin to IIS6 / Windows2003
server.
Most pages still work, but any with a date function do not.
The database now only returns certain dates, for example 10/10/2007 works,
but 01/09/2007 does not, even thougth this date has valid database entries.
The fault is reproduceable at:
http://www.derbyshiremason.org/newpglroot/masonicConcepts/calendar.asp
I have tried changing the locale to both US and GB, but this does not affect
the problem.
I have heard that date formats in IIS6 /SQL2003 have changed so that they
now have date and time.
Any ideas?
